Solar PV Installation Options
Different properties require different installation approaches depending on roof structure, available space and operational use.
On-roof solar PV systems
Installed above the existing roof covering and suited to many residential and commercial buildings.
In-roof solar PV systems
Integrated into the roofline and often selected for roof replacement projects, extensions and newer developments.
Flat roof solar PV systems
Suitable for warehouses, offices, retail premises and industrial buildings with low-pitched or flat roof areas.
Ground mounted solar PV systems
Useful for larger plots, operational sites and properties with suitable surrounding land.
Solar PV Planned Around Energy Usage
A solar PV system should reflect how the building uses electricity throughout the day rather than simply maximising the number of panels installed.
Residential properties may be planning around daytime electricity use, future EV charging or battery storage, while commercial premises may need to support operational equipment, lighting, refrigeration or office systems during working hours.
Where battery storage is being considered for backup during a power cut, an EPS/battery with island mode function will be required for the battery to function during a power cut.
System design can take into account:
- electricity demand
- roof orientation and shading
- future expansion plans
- battery storage integration
- Smart Export Guarantee eligibility
- available installation space

Roof Replacement & Integrated Solar Projects
Roof condition should always be considered before solar PV installation takes place, particularly on older commercial buildings and properties undergoing refurbishment.
Where roofing work is already planned, in-roof solar systems can sometimes be incorporated into the wider project. Renewable Planet can also support replacement roof work where required before installation begins.
This can help avoid disruption later and ensure the solar PV system is installed onto a roof suitable for long-term performance.
Smart Export Guarantee Support
Eligible solar PV systems may be able to export surplus electricity back to the grid through the Smart Export Guarantee.
Export suitability depends on the system installed, metering arrangements and supplier requirements. Renewable Planet can advise on SEG eligibility as part of the planning process.
